WebThe wide band gap and high thermal stability of SiC enable some types of SiC devices to work indefinitely at junction temperature of 300C or higher without measurable performance degradation. 2. In wide band gap semiconductors, SiC is special because it can easily dope p-type or n-type in the range of more than 5 orders of magnitude. 3. WebMar 6, 2016 · The fabrication of low-resistance and thermal stable ohmic contacts is important for realization of reliable SiC devices. For the n-type SiC, Ni-based metallization is most commonly used for Schottky and ohmic contacts. WebFor n-type it has been assumed that the number of k-type donors is the same as the number of h-type donors. Thus, the nitrogen donor level was set to the average value for all sites, =70 and =100 meV for 4H and 6H-SiC, respectively. The p-type results were calculated assuming the aluminum acceptor value =200 meV. WebNov 11, 2016 · In particular, in the case of p-type SiC, Ti/Al and Ti/Al/W contacts showed a superior Ohmic behavior after annealing at 900–1100 °C (with ρ c ≈ 1.5–6 × 10 −4 Ωcm 2), attributed to the formation of Ti- and Al-containing phases at the interface and in the stack.

WebNov 8, 2024 · SiC Schottky diodes have found many different applications, mainly in power electronics. They can be found in applications related to solar cells, electric and hybrid vehicle power systems, radio frequency detectors, power rectifier circuits, and industrial power.
